In 2016, Arcon Recruitment Services implemented Mercury RM ATS, an Applicant Tracking System to formalize recruiting operations for its 10-person professional services firm. Implementation focused on core Applicant Tracking System capabilities, including a centralized candidate database, vacancy and job posting management, pipeline workflows, CV parsing and screening workflows, interview scheduling, and offer tracking, configured to match recruiter-led processes and small-team operational needs. The deployment emphasized lightweight configuration, role-based access for recruiters and client-facing staff, and user training to consolidate candidate records and standardize resourcing activity.
Configuration and governance work codified best-practice recruitment workflows and process controls, enabling Arcon to enforce consistent shortlisting, interview and placement steps across engagements. Arcon reported in March 2016 that with Mercury xRM the business achieved a streamlined recruitment process and a system that allows the firm to follow best practice, indicating operational consolidation of candidate lifecycle management. The implementation directly impacted recruiting and resourcing business functions and centralized pipeline management for Arcon Recruitment Services.

In 2021, Arcon Recruitment Services implemented Tawk.to on its public website, embedding the Tawk.to chat widget as a customer facing conversational entry point. The implementation is classified under Chatbots and Conversational AI and serves as the primary digital engagement layer for the company’s recruitment and client inquiry workflows.
The deployment uses the Tawk.to JavaScript widget to provide live chat messaging, automated greetings and canned responses, visitor monitoring and message transcripts. Management and routing of inbound chats are handled by the recruitment team, with chat handling configured for real time candidate engagement and asynchronous follow up when agents are offline. The configuration emphasizes lightweight operational governance appropriate for a 10 person professional services firm, keeping conversational configuration and transcript access centralized within the recruiting function.
